Uniview KIT/1*ISW5000-8GT4GP-POE-IN/1*PWR-DC5428-A-NB, Harsh POE Switch Package
The KIT/1 ISW5000-8GT4GP-POE-IN/1PWR-DC5428-A-NB is a powerful industrial-grade PoE switch package designed for use in harsh and demanding environments. It delivers both data and power through Ethernet cables, following IEEE 802.3af/at standards. Each PoE port can supply up to 30 watts of power, which is enough for devices like IP cameras, wireless access points, or VoIP phones. The switch supports transmission distances of up to 100 meters, making it suitable for wide-area deployments.
This model includes eight Gigabit Ethernet ports with PoE and four additional Gigabit SFP ports for fiber or uplink connections. These ports ensure fast and stable data transmission across the network. Full-duplex IEEE 802.3x flow control and half-duplex backpressure flow control help maintain reliable communication and reduce data collisions.
LED indicators on the front panel show the real-time status of each port and help users identify problems quickly. The switch supports one-click ring network setup, allowing users to create a self-healing ring topology that restores connectivity in case of link failure. One-click storm suppression prevents broadcast storms that can bring down a network.
The switch supports STP, RSTP, and MSTP protocols, which improve network reliability by preventing loops. Link aggregation through LACP or static configuration increases bandwidth and provides redundancy. This feature ensures continuous operation even if one link fails.
Users can manage the switch through Console, Telnet, SSH, or a web-based interface. The simple web interface makes setup and monitoring faster and easier. Engineers can also upload or download firmware and configuration files using TFTP.
